TJ Rogers Skateboard Setup (2026)
TJ Rogers is a Canadian professional street skateboarder from Whitby, Ontario, born October 26, 1991.
Current setup: Sk8 Mafia Pro model 8.25" deck · Independent Trucks Stage 11 trucks · Bones Wheels wheels

TJ Rogers Setup FAQ
What deck does TJ Rogers ride?
TJ Rogers rides a Sk8 Mafia Pro model 8.25" deck in a 8.25" width as of 2026. Deck choice is the single biggest factor in a pro's setup — width affects stance and stability, while concave and construction drive pop and flick. What trucks does TJ Rogers use?
TJ Rogers uses Independent Trucks Stage 11 trucks. Trucks determine how a skateboard turns and how it lands grinds, and pros typically match hanger width to deck width for proper alignment. Most pro skaters stick with one truck brand for years once they have the feel dialed in.
What wheels does TJ Rogers ride?
TJ Rogers rides Bones Wheels wheels. Wheel size and hardness drive speed and grip — smaller, harder wheels favor technical street skating, while larger, softer wheels suit transition, park, and rougher terrain.
What shoes does TJ Rogers skate in?
TJ Rogers skates in éS Footwear TJ Rogers. Skate shoes are built with reinforced toe caps, vulcanized or cupsole construction, and grippy gum rubber outsoles for board feel and durability. Pros often go through several pairs a month from heavy daily skating.
What bearings does TJ Rogers use?
TJ Rogers uses Quantum bearings. Bearings determine roll speed and how long your wheels keep spinning, and a properly maintained set should last as long as your wheels with regular cleaning. Pros usually upgrade bearings before swapping wheels.
About TJ Rogers
TJ Rogers is a Canadian professional street skateboarder from Whitby, Ontario, born October 26, 1991. He rides for SK8MAFIA and has established a reputation for heavy, committed street skating, particularly on rails and stairs. Rogers is one of the most prominent Canadian pros on the international street scene and has appeared in multiple SK8MAFIA video productions.
